Bed bugs return to Athens courthouse

By Joe Johnson

The county government has announced that Municipal Court will be closed today and tomorrow due to bedbug infestation,

This makes the third time since July 2024 that the courthouse on East Washington Street has experienced closures for bedbug extermination.

Last year, the entire building was closed by anemergency order by Western Judicial Circuit Chief Judge Lisa Lott to provide the necessary multi-day measures to treat the infestation.

Bed bugs are small, flat, parasitic insects that cannot fly. They are usually transported from place to place as people travel. Bed bugs can be transported from many different sources, including schools, hotels, and used furniture.

According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), bed bugs are not known to spread disease and do not usually pose a serious medical threat. Bed bugs have been found in five-star hotels and resorts and their presence is not determined by the cleanliness of the living conditions where they are found.
